Securing Nigerian Communities (SNC) is a Department of State-funded project designed to increase access to information, equip key stakeholders with practical violence reduction tools, and forge new social connections across conflicting groups, while addressing the systemic inequities that present barriers to human security. 

In recent months, in the heart of Jos South Local Government Area (LGA), the EAI-led Early Warning and Early Response (EWER) initiative has emerged as a cornerstone of community resilience amidst escalating tensions in Nigeria. The issue unfolded when a Muslim youth from the Bukuru Community was apprehended for theft by members of the Hunters Association of Nigeria, a local community policing structure. The Hunters Association reportedly tortured the youth until he was unconscious. Then Muslim youths from that community subsequently mobilized a protest, posing a threat to inter-communal harmony along religious lines.

At this pivotal moment, EWER members exhibited exceptional leadership and collaboration. Acknowledging the urgency of the situation, they promptly engaged with community leaders, security personnel, and stakeholders from various backgrounds, including representatives from both Islamic and Christian leadership groups. Through deliberate dialogue and mediation efforts, EWER members successfully alleviated tensions and pacified the protesters, thus preventing a potential crisis.  

The impact of the EWER structure’s proactive intervention extended beyond mere conflict resolution. It also facilitated immediate medical attention for the tortured individual and arranged the arrest of the responsible Hunters’ Association personnel by the police. This decisive action not only ensured justice but also fostered trust between communities and law enforcement agencies, nurturing a sense of security and unity.
